What I'm looking for

I seek a quantitative policy or analyst role in energy or sustainability-focused organisations where I can apply econometrics, data visualisation, and policy insight to drive decarbonisation.

I am an environmental economist with a strong quantitative background and a First Class MA (Hons) from the University of Edinburgh, experienced in energy, sustainability policy, and data analysis. My dissertation used cross-country panel methods to study renewable investment dynamics, and my coursework includes econometrics and statistical methods.

I have practical experience across research, consulting, and industry placements: modelling campus energy use with Excel and Power BI, conducting VC due diligence for renewable startups, and tracking net-zero policy progress for an open-source database. I publish policy and economics pieces for Earth.Org and have authored multiple articles synthesising academic and policy sources.

I combine technical skills (Stata, R Studio, Power BI, advanced Excel) with stakeholder engagement and project delivery from leadership roles in university sport finance and consulting. I seek opportunities where I can apply quantitative analysis and policy insight to accelerate decarbonisation and sustainable investment.
